STEP 5. Check the wiring harness between driver's door lock key cylinder switch connector E-14 and ground.

NOTE:  Also check intermediate connector C-91. If intermediate connectors C-91 is damaged, repair or replace the connector as described in Harness
Connector Inspection.

Q: Is the wiring harness between driver's door lock key cylinder switch connector E-14 and ground in good condition?

YES: No action to be taken.

NO: Repair the wiring harness. If the systems, which are described in "CIRCUIT OPERATION", work normally, the input signal from the driver's
door lock key cylinder switch should be normal.

STEP 6. Check driver's door lock key cylinder switch connector E-14 and ETACS-ECU connector C-117 for damage.

Q: Are driver's door lock key cylinder switch connector E-14 and ETACS-ECU connector C-117 in good condition? 

YES: Go to Step 7.
